Hurricanes v Chiefs: Teams
Jayden Hayward and Charlie Ngatai will make their Hurricanes debut against the Chiefs on Saturday.

Hayward will replace the suspended Ma'a Nonu, while Ngatai will start on the bench.
Andre Taylor, Chris Eaton, Mark Reddish and Neemia Tialata are also promoted into the starting XV.
Tim Nanai-Williams will move to full-back for the Chiefs after Mils Muliaina was ruled out for a month.
Muliaina damaged his back against the Rebels, so Liam Messam will take over the captaincy.
"It's been disappointing to lose Mils, but we are happy with the overall condition of the squad and we are confident in the leadership of the team with our core group going well," said coach Ian Foster.
There is also another change on the bench with Fitz Lee returning after a knee injury.
Hurricanes: 15 Cory Jane, 14 Julian Savea, 13 Conrad Smith, 12 Jayden Hayward, 11 Andre Taylor, 10 Aaron Cruden, 9 Chris Eaton, 8 Victor Vito, 7 Serge Lilo, 6 Jack Lam, 5 Jason Eaton, 4 James Broadhurst, 3 Neemia Tialata 2 Andrew Hore (c), 1 John Schwalger
Replacements: 16 Dane Coles, 17 Anthony Perenise, 18 Mark Reddish, 19 Faifili Levave, 20 Tyson Keats, 21 Daniel Kirkpatrick, 22 Charlie Ngatai
Chiefs: 15 Tim Nanai-Williams, 14 Lelia Masaga, 13 Dwayne Sweeney, 12 Tana Umaga, 11 Sitiveni Sivivatu, 10 Stephen Donald, 9 Brendon Leonard, 8 Liam Messam (c), 7 Tanerau Latimer, 6 Scott Waldrom, 5 Isaac Ross, 4 Craig Clarke, 3 Nathan White, 2 Aled de Malmanche, 1 Ben May.
Replacements: 16 Hika Elliot, 17 Sona Taumalolo, 18 Romana Graham, 19 Fritz Lee, 20 Taniela Moa, 21 Mike Delany, 22 Jackson Willison.
